Face ID: how to unlock iPhone with Apple Watch?

With iOS 14.5, Apple will allow Face ID to unlock your iPhone using your Apple Watch, even when you are wearing a mask.

Unlock iPhone with Apple Watch

For several months, we have been forced to wear a mask in public places, which becomes complicated when you want to use Face ID to unlock your iPhone. Indeed, this facial recognition system and the mask do not mix. This problem is the same for all iOS users and owners of a model later than the X, that is, without Touch ID technology.

To overcome this limitation, you can always use an access code. However, if you don’t want to have to type it every time, then follow our solution (below) which we think is more practical, provided you have an Apple Watch.

This is an unlocking process offered on the latest version of iOS 14.5, currently in beta testing, before it officially releases in March, or early April. If you want to try it out now, then join Apple’s public program.

Once installed, read on to learn how to unlock your iOS using your Apple smartwatch.

Unlock your iPhone with your Apple Watch

For this feature to work, your Apple Watch must be running watchOS 7.4. It will also need to be on your wrist, unlocked and its detection activated.

Also, an access code will have to be configured on your iOS. If not, then go to Settings →  Face ID & Passcode → Activate Passcode.

To access your iPhone through your Apple Watch, activate the Unlock with Apple Watch feature on your iPhone. For it:

  • Open Settings
  • Go to Face ID and code
  • Choose Unlock with Apple Watch

Now your iOS will automatically unlock and your Apple Watch will notify you with a haptic notification.
